--- Comment #8 from mathog <mathog at caltech.edu> 2011-10-12 09:58:44 PDT ---
Stranger and stranger.
In Powerpoint:
Create an identical shape using the drawing tools, a couple of overlapping
rectangles with no edge line.
Select all.
Cut
Paste special (PNG).
Copy
In Impress
Paste
right click
convert -> polygon
The conversion settings dialog appears, let it run.
right click
break
The desired polygon object is present, along with some white polygons.
So....
When the original object is imported it is a "picture", but it is not one that
"convert -> polygon" will operate on. There is no error message, no settings
dialog, it just fails (or does something else) silently.
